Record #256 from Manumissions in Somerset and Worcester County Land Records, 1825-1866

Name (Slaveowner) Cathell, Henry
Name (Enslaved person) _Henny White, Henry Kirk _Edward _William
Additional Information free negro Cathell frees wife Henny 25 yo & her son Henry Kirk White 3 yo; both purchased from Washington Bennett late of SO on 20 Sep 1824. Cathell's & Henny's son Edward 8 yo purchased from Bennett 5 Oct 1833; his 6 yo son William, child of Henny, purchased from Jeptha Morris & his son Huston 2 yo son of Henny born since he purchased her. Henny, Henry Kirk White, Edward, William & Huston to be free 4 Mar 1837.
Document Date 1837 Mar 4
County Somerset
Liber GH 9
Folio 32
